requirements for superintendent administrator alternative certification. The applicant for a superintendent alternative certification shall: (1) Have a master's degree or higher from a regionally-accredited institution of higher education; and (2) Have three or more years of experience in a management role in a business, public school, or department-accredited school, or be employed as a teacher with a leadership role in a public or department-accredited school.
Source: 43 SDR 175, effective July 3, 2017; 47 SDR 68, effective December 10, 2020.
